Local context

About this constituency

Earley and Woodley lies immediately east of Reading and is centred on the adjoining suburban communities of Earley and Woodley. The constituency also includes nearby settlements and residential areas within Wokingham borough, forming part of the wider Reading urban area. Earley and Woodley each have their own local centres, schools, parks and residential neighbourhoods, while major road and rail links provide connections to Reading, Wokingham and London. The River Loddon and surrounding green spaces create some breaks in development, particularly toward the eastern and southern edges. Overall, the seat is predominantly suburban and commuter-oriented rather than rural or focused on a single historic town.

Latest election

2024 General Election

Held on 4 July 2024

Winning party
Labour
Majority
848
Turnout
62.4%
Full candidate result (5 candidates)
CandidatePartyVotesShareChange
Yuan YangElectedLabour18,20939.7%13.0%
Pauline JorgensenConservative17,36137.8%-10.9%
Tahir MaherLiberal Democrat6,14213.4%-8.4%
Gary ShackladyGreen Party3,4187.4%5.2%
Alastair HunterSocial Democratic Party7841.7%
